Just that now though, I'm going through the Grey Clan quest, and at the Friendly Arm Inn, I am encountering two glitches. The first is during the cutscene of when you first enter the FFA and High Sorceress Linda is going to try to get the items from the Mold Golem even though the keys are most likely inserted in the wrong order. The problem is, there is no Mold Golem. So what happens in my installation is that Linda and Vladimir remain "friendly" while the bandits and orogs attack. Game play can continue from here, where you encounter the other side quest characters of the mod and other normal encounters with the bandits inside the FFA. The second glitch that I've encountered is on the second floor, where Mary is suppose to be in stone form. Again, no Mary. However, I've gotten around this little glitch using the CLAU and inserted here that way. I thought this would have also worked with the Mold Golem, but when I try to use the CLAU, and I 'think' that the file name of that creature is 'bw05mgol', I get the error that the file does not exist. Without the Mold Golem, I cannot insert the keys to obtain the items that it's carrying so that I can complete this quest. The Mold Golem should be "bw05mgol.cre" so the code you have to insert is:
CLUAConsole:CreateCreature("bw05mgol")
But you could also try this:
CLUAConsole:CreateCreature("bw05mold")
And see what happens( I don't remember was it the Mold Golem or the Crystal Servant that is required).

In your TGC1e\Actors folder in your BGII-SoA folder (lol :P) there should be a BW05MGOL.CRE ... put that file into the override folder for a temporary fix. The names would be messed up but it beats being unable to complete the quest right?? :D ... I guess :P

PS: You might still need to CLUA the golem in after copying the file ;)

Well, problem here is that the original .cre file (which got patched during the install ... many times over :P) somehow got deleted before being biffed!

You might wanna do a changelog (according to point #6 in the Megamod FAQ in my sig) of BW05MGOL.CRE - AFTER you delete/remove/cut the new file you copied into the override ;) Might give the guys here some clues :P
